Description

Vibro-Meter VM600-ABE040 – Rack Backplane for VM600 Machinery Protection and Condition MonitoringVM600-ABE040

The Vibro-Meter VM600-ABE040 is the backplane assembly used in VM600 racks, providing the power distribution, system bus, and rear terminations that tie your VM600 measurement and protection modules together. From my experience, this is the piece that quietly ensures the whole system stays stable—especially on compressor trains, steam turbines, and large critical pumps where uptime matters more than anything.

You might notice that most channel expansion projects or control-room upgrades end up touching the ABE040. It’s the backbone: modules plug in from the front, field wiring lands at the rear, and the backplane routes power and the VM600 system bus reliably across every slot. One thing I appreciate is how it supports mixed configurations—protection and condition monitoring cards side-by-side—without complicating wiring or future service.

Key Features

  • System backbone for VM600 – Distributes power and the VM600 system bus to all plug‑in modules, keeping the rack coherent and serviceable.
  • Redundancy‑ready power distribution – In most cases supports dual 24 VDC rack supplies, improving availability for protection applications.
  • Rear field terminations – Clean separation of process wiring at the rear, with modules accessible from the front for hot‑swap servicing.
  • Mixed module compatibility – Typically accepts both protection and condition monitoring modules in the same rack, simplifying channel expansion.
  • Industrial build quality – Robust backplane construction suited for control cabinets in harsh plant environments; conformal‑coated variants are common in many installations.
  • Service friendly – Clear slot addressing and guided module insertion reduce maintenance errors during shutdowns.

Technical Specifications

Brand / Model Vibro-Meter VM600-ABE040
Product Type VM600 rack backplane assembly (power and system bus distribution, rear terminations)
HS Code 903180 (Measuring/monitoring instruments; typical classification for condition monitoring hardware)
Power Requirements 24 VDC nominal via rack power supplies (backplane power distribution; no independent input)
Operating Temperature Typically 0 to +55 °C when installed in a ventilated control cabinet
Signal I/O Types (via modules) Backplane provides rear terminations for installed VM600 modules (e.g., dynamic vibration, speed/tacho, temperature, and relay outputs as provided by the respective cards)
Communication Interfaces VM600 system bus on backplane; Ethernet and serial interfaces are provided by the CPUM module when fitted
Installation Method 19-inch rack mounting (VM600 rack format); modules plug in from the front, field wiring at the rear

Installation & Maintenance

  • Cabinet and mounting – Install in a 19-inch control cabinet with adequate ventilation (top/bottom airflow). Maintain clearances for cable radii and front module access.
  • Power and grounding – Use clean 24 VDC supplies; for protection service, dual redundant supplies are typically used. Bond rack ground to the cabinet earth; maintain shield terminations as per VM600 wiring practices.
  • Wiring – Land transducer and I/O wiring on the rear terminals. Keep dynamic signal cables separated from power conductors; route tacho leads away from high‑noise sources.
  • Safety – Isolate DC power before adding/removing modules. Observe ESD precautions when handling the backplane and cards.
  • Routine checks – Periodically inspect rear terminals, tighten as needed, and verify grounding. From my experience, a quick visual of connector seating after outages prevents many intermittent issues.
  • Firmware/config – Apply firmware updates to CPUM and relevant modules during planned maintenance. Keep a current backup of the rack configuration.
